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Kolumnę, z jednej tabeli do drugiej.
Andrzej Sztuczka
post
Post #1





Grupa: Zarejestrowani
Postów: 20
Pomógł: 0
Dołączył: 28.05.2003

Ostrzeżenie: (0%)
-----


....

Ten post edytował Andrzej Sztuczka 16.08.2008, 22:27:34
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i (1 - 4)
spenalzo
post
Post #2





Grupa: Zarejestrowani
Postów: 2 064
Pomógł: 1
Dołączył: 22.01.2003
Skąd: Poznań

Ostrzeżenie: (0%)
-----


Hmm, napisz trochę dokładniej: czy same dane, czy także strukturę itd.

A najlepiej użyć np. phpMyAdmina.


--------------------

Go to the top of the page
+Quote Post
Sh4dow
post
Post #3





Grupa: Zarejestrowani
Postów: 569
Pomógł: 0
Dołączył: 17.08.2003
Skąd: Dąbrowa Górnicza

Ostrzeżenie: (0%)
-----


to doda ci kolumne oceny do tabeli tomek

[sql:1:51dcb724e4]ALTER TABLE `tomek` ADD 'oceny` VARCHAR( 50 ) NOT NULL [/sql:1:51dcb724e4]

musisz exportowac dane z tabeli mirek (najlepiej phpMyAdmin) i dodac do tabeli tomek, jedynym problemem moze byc to ze ID z tabeli mirek, moze kolidowac z tym ze id w tabeli tomek pewnie jest ustawione na autonumerowanie. Musial bys recznie jakos to zrobic zeby zaladowalo do odpowiedniej tabeli. życze powodzenia.


--------------------
Warsztat: Linux: PHP, MySQL, Apache, NetBeans, C++, Qt-Creator
Użytkownik, słowo którego specjaliści IT używają, gdy chcą powiedzieć idiota
Zarządzaj swoim budżetem domowym
Go to the top of the page
+Quote Post
FiDO
post
Post #4





Grupa: Przyjaciele php.pl
Postów: 1 717
Pomógł: 0
Dołączył: 12.06.2002
Skąd: Wolsztyn..... Studia: Zielona Góra

Ostrzeżenie: (0%)
-----


W ogole to proponuje przeprojektowac baze, bo robienie osobnej tabeli dla kazdej osoby nie jest dobrym wyjsciem...
Go to the top of the page
+Quote Post
uboottd
post
Post #5





Grupa: Zarejestrowani
Postów: 384
Pomógł: 0
Dołączył: 3.04.2003
Skąd: Chorzow

Ostrzeżenie: (0%)
-----


Dobra, widze ze nikt nie dal nic lepszego, wiec dam grzyba:

Szkic rozwiazania:

1. Alter table docelowej zeby zalozyc ta kolumne
2. multi update dla danych ktore maja w zrodlowej ten sam klucz co w docelowej
3. insert ... select dla danych ktore nie maja swojego odpowiednika w tabeli docelowej
4. alter table zrodlowej zeby usunac kolumne

Ale jedno pytanie co do przykladu:
Jak chcesz miec w jednej kolumnie 1 wpis a w drugiej 300 w tej samej tabeli ?
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 20.08.2025 - 06:04